Preventing Equipment Failures and Accidents
Low-quality casters often develop flat spots, seize unexpectedly, or suffer structural damage such as frame bending, all of which can cause equipment to tip, collapse, or stop abruptly. These failures significantly increase the likelihood of workplace injuries and costly disruptions. By investing in heavy-duty casters made from high-strength, durable materials, businesses can enhance load stability and operational safety. Reliable casters withstand demanding environments, reduce maintenance requirements, and help prevent accidents caused by equipment malfunctions.
Noise Reduction and Enhanced Focus
Workplace acoustics play a critical role in maintaining focus, communication, and overall safety. High-quality casters designed with noise-reducing materials like polyurethane treads minimize the clatter and sharp sounds commonly produced by carts and equipment in motion. By reducing unnecessary noise, facilities create a more comfortable, less stressful environment for employees. Improved sound control enhances team communication, supports concentration on detailed tasks, and contributes to accident prevention while promoting smoother, more efficient daily operations.
The Role of Regular Maintenance
Regular maintenance and inspection ensure that casters remain in good working condition and continue to provide the safety benefits they were chosen for. Over time, casters may collect debris or show signs of wear, affecting their performance. By adhering to a maintenance schedule, facility managers can spot potential problems, such as worn treads or loose fasteners, before they compromise worker safety. Periodic upkeep goes hand-in-hand with investing in quality casters, ensuring they deliver value over the long term.
Choosing the Right Casters for Your Workplace
Different workspaces require different caster solutions. For clean and quiet office environments, non-marking polyurethane or rubber casters are suitable, preserving floor surfaces and minimizing noise. In contrast, heavy-duty areas such as factories or distribution centers require metal-core casters that offer greater durability and higher weight capacities. Environmental considerations such as exposure to water, chemicals, or uneven surfaces also factor into the choice. For these settings, specialty casters designed for specific hazards or resistance are available.
